CDC walks back hundreds of firings as US shutdown persists
- Saturday, the Trump administration raced to rescind layoffs of hundreds of Centers for Disease Control and Prevention scientists mistakenly fired Friday night after The New York Times report.
- An Office of Management and Budget announcement amid the shutdown prompted layoffs at the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, while a coding error mistakenly targeted Ebola and measles response teams.
- Epidemic Intelligence Service members and Morbidity and Mortality Weekly Report staff, along with the top two leaders of the federal measles response and Ebola teams, were wrongly dismissed.
- A senior administration official said incorrect notifications were fixed last night with a technical correction, and rescind notices will follow in a few days, despite criticism from Dr. Debra Houry.
- Earlier staff reductions and a gunman firing more than 500 rounds at the Atlanta headquarters amplified CDC turmoil amid ongoing layoffs and rehiring errors.
